What is warehouse logistics? At its core, warehouse logistics represents the strategic orchestration of physical goods movement and information systems within storage facilities, transforming chaotic storage into a streamlined profit machine that keeps customers coming back for more. This critical component of supply chain management involves the systematic coordination of receiving, storing, picking, packing, and shipping products while maintaining optimal inventory control and customer satisfaction.

Modern warehouse logistics encompasses far more than simple storage solutions. It's about creating an efficient supply chain that maximises warehouse space, reduces operating costs, and enhances operational efficiency. Understanding Warehouse Logistics and Inventory Tracking Fundamentals for Chain Management

The Core of Supply Chain Success with Raw Materials Integration

To define warehouse logistics effectively, we must recognise it as the strategic management of physical flow and information systems within storage facilities that efficiently store inventory. Unlike general logistics operations, which encompass the entire movement of goods from supplier to customer, warehouse logistics specifically focuses on the complex operations involved within the storage area itself.

The symbiotic relationship between physical goods movement and data flow forms the foundation of effective warehouse management. Physical inventory moves through distinct stages: receiving raw materials and finished products, storing them in designated storage areas with proper stock rotation protocols, retrieving items for customer orders through controlling inventory systems, and preparing them for final destination delivery. Simultaneously, inventory tracking systems monitor stock levels, forecast customer demand, and provide warehouse managers with the informed decisions needed to maximise space whilst maintaining optimal inventory levels.

The distinction between warehouse logistics and supply chain management lies in scope and focus. Supply chain management encompasses the entire process from raw materials procurement to customer delivery, while warehouse logistics concentrates on the specific warehouse tasks and processes that occur within storage facilities. However, both must work in harmony to create an efficient storage system that meets customer demand consistently.

The Six-Step Warehouse Logistics Process for Inventory Control and Operating Costs

Female warehouse worker moving boxes on a pallet jack, showing inventory control process.

From Receiving to Shipping Excellence with Quality Control and Order Preparation

The warehouse logistics process involves six critical stages that determine operational efficiency and customer satisfaction. Each stage requires careful coordination, proper training, and advanced technologies to function optimally within the broader logistics warehouse framework.

Step 1: Receiving and Quality Control

When goods arrive at distribution centres, warehouse teams document, track, and authorise receipt of products. This stage involves verifying quantities against purchase orders, inspecting for damage, confirming delivery times, and validating pricing. Effective receiving processes establish the foundation for accurate inventory tracking throughout the entire process.

Step 2: Inventory Management and Storage

Strategic storage of received goods requires optimal warehouse layout design and efficient storage solutions that maximise space utilisation. High-turnover items should be positioned in easily accessible areas with proper stock rotation systems, whilst slower-moving stock can be stored in less accessible locations. Modern warehouses utilise automated storage and retrieval systems to maximise space whilst maintaining inventory accuracy through controlling inventory protocols that ensure proper stock rotation.

Step 3: Warehouse Layout Optimisation

Efficient warehouse design minimises travel time and maximises floor space utilisation through strategic planning of the physical flow. The common U-shaped layout positions receiving at one end, storage in the middle, and shipping at the opposite end, creating a logical flow of goods that reduces handling time and improves productivity whilst supporting complex operations efficiently.

Step 4: Order Picking Strategies

This stage consumes approximately 55% of all operating costs in warehouse operations. Effective picking strategies include batch picking for multiple orders simultaneously and zone picking for products stored in specific warehouse areas. Advanced warehouse management systems coordinate these activities to improve warehouse logistics efficiency.

Step 5: Packing and Order Preparation

The packing area serves as the final quality control checkpoint before customer delivery. Proper picking and packing protect products during transit, including appropriate labelling, and update inventory management software with shipment details. This stage directly impacts customer satisfaction through accurate, undamaged deliveries.

Step 6: Shipping and Customer Delivery

The final stage coordinates transportation, monitors shipments in transit, and resolves delivery issues. Effective scheduling of deliveries and coordinating with logistics partners ensures products reach their final destination within promised timeframes.

Common Challenges and Strategic Solutions for Logistics Warehouse Operations

Large warehouse filled with stacked boxes and shelves, representing logistics challenges and solutions.

Overcoming Warehouse Logistics Obstacles with Systems That Integrate Seamlessly

Australian businesses face numerous challenges when implementing effective warehouse logistics, but strategic solutions can address these obstacles while improving overall performance.

  • Inventory Management Complexity: Modern businesses often sell through multiple channels, creating complex inventory management requirements. Products must be tracked across online stores, physical retail locations, and B2B customers simultaneously. Advanced warehouse management systems integrate seamlessly with various sales channels, providing unified inventory tracking and automated stock level adjustments.
  • Labour Shortages and Proper Training: The Australian logistics industry faces ongoing labour shortages, with many positions requiring specialised skills. Solutions include comprehensive training programmes, competitive compensation packages, and automation technologies that reduce reliance on manual labour. Companies investing in proper training report 25% lower employee turnover rates and significantly improved operational efficiency.
  • Space Constraints and Maximising Space: Rising property costs in major Australian cities create pressure to maximise space utilisation within existing facilities. Solutions include vertical storage systems, automated storage solutions, and warehouse layout optimisation. These improvements can increase storage capacity by 40% without expanding the physical footprint.
  • Maintaining Real-Time Inventory Tracking: Accurate inventory tracking becomes increasingly challenging as warehouse operations expand. Modern inventory management software provides real-time visibility, automated updates, and predictive analytics that help warehouse managers make informed decisions about stock levels, reorder points, and storage allocation.
  • Integration Challenges: Many businesses struggle to integrate warehouse management systems with existing ERP, accounting, and sales platforms. Selecting systems designed to integrate seamlessly with existing infrastructure ensures smooth data flow and eliminates manual data entry errors.
  • Technology Adoption: While advanced technologies offer significant benefits, implementation can be challenging. Successful adoption requires careful planning, employee training, and phased implementation that minimises disruption to ongoing operations.

Best Practices to Improve Warehouse Logistics Excellence with Proper Training

Implementing Data-Driven Operations for Logistics Warehouses with Advanced Technologies

Proven strategies for warehouse excellence focus on data-driven decision making, strategic technology adoption, and continuous improvement in warehouse processes.

  • Data-Driven Decision Making: Successful warehouse managers rely on key performance indicators (KPIs) to guide operational decisions. Essential metrics include inventory turnover rates, order accuracy percentages, picking productivity, and customer satisfaction scores. Regular analysis of these metrics identifies improvement opportunities and guides resource allocation decisions.
  • Warehouse Space Optimisation: Efficient storage maximises available space through strategic layout design, vertical storage solutions, and dynamic storage allocation. Australian businesses should consider seasonal demand patterns, product characteristics, and handling requirements when designing storage areas. Proper space utilisation can reduce storage costs by up to 30% whilst improving accessibility.
  • Strategic Technology Investment: Implementing warehouse management systems requires careful evaluation of return on investment (ROI). Priority should be given to technologies that address specific operational challenges, integrate seamlessly with existing systems, and provide measurable benefits. Common technology investments include automated storage systems, inventory management software, and warehouse robotics.
  • Comprehensive Staff Training Programmes: Proper training ensures employees understand warehouse processes, safety procedures, and technology systems. Well-trained staff make fewer errors, work more efficiently, and contribute to improved customer satisfaction. Training programmes should cover both technical skills and safety procedures to ensure comprehensive workforce development.
  • Continuous Improvement Culture: Implementing a culture of continuous improvement encourages employees to identify inefficiencies and suggest improvements. Regular process reviews, employee feedback sessions, and performance analysis drive ongoing optimisation of warehouse operations.
  • Quality Control Integration: Effective quality control processes should be integrated throughout warehouse operations, from receiving to shipping. This comprehensive approach ensures product quality, reduces returns, and maintains customer satisfaction whilst protecting the company's reputation.
